Responsibilities

Summary of Job Responsibilities:

  • Ensure appropriate execution, implementation, effectiveness, and oversight of the Market compliance program by serving as the Market Compliance Officer, maintaining collaborative relationships with stakeholders, and chairing/participating in the Market/System Compliance Committees.
  • Consult administrative leadership and operations to help ensure all Market services, policies, and procedures are in compliance with agency standards, regulatory mandates, accrediting bodies, and regulations as appropriate.
  • Develop and oversee implementation of appropriate compliance-related education based on identified compliance risks.
  • Coordinate internal investigations, in consultation with UPH Legal Counsel and UPH Chief Compliance Officer, related to compliance issues/concerns (including referrals from the Compliance Helpline) and compile information for review with the Compliance Committee to determine appropriate action.
  • Assess Market’s risk and participate in the development of the annual UPH Compliance Work Plan, Market Compliance Work Plan, and resulting corrective action plans.
  • Work with the management team in the design and implementation of compliance initiatives to ensure adherence to compliance standards and consistent discipline as appropriate.
  • Work with the management team in the design and implementation of auditing and monitoring strategies to mitigate identified compliance risks.
